路径优化算法,探索与应用
路径优化算法是计算机科学领域中一种重要的算法,广泛应用于城市规划、交通管理、物流运输等领域,路径优化算法的主要目标是在给定的网络中找到最优的路径,使得该路径满足特定的优化标准,如距离最短、时间最少等,本文将介绍路径优化算法的基本概念、分类、应用场景以及最新进展。
路径优化算法概述
路径优化算法是一种在图中寻找最优路径的算法,在计算机科学中,图是由节点和边组成的集合,节点表示地点或状态,边表示地点之间的连接或状态之间的转移,路径优化算法的目标是在图中找到一条从起点到终点的路径,使得该路径满足特定的优化条件,这些条件可以是距离最短、时间最少、成本最低等,路径优化算法广泛应用于各种场景,如导航系统、物流运输、通信网络等。
路径优化算法分类
路径优化算法可以根据不同的分类标准进行分类,常见的分类方式包括:
1、按照求解方法分类:包括贪心算法、动态规划、图搜索算法等。
2、按照优化目标分类:包括最短路径算法、最小时间路径算法、最小成本路径算法等。
3、按照问题规模分类:包括小规模路径优化问题、中规模路径优化问题和大规模路径优化问题等。
路径优化算法的应用场景
路径优化算法在实际应用中具有广泛的应用场景,主要包括以下几个方面:

1、导航系统:路径优化算法是导航系统的重要组成部分,用于计算最优的导航路线,通过考虑道路拥堵、交通状况等因素,为用户提供最短时间或最短距离的路线建议。
2、物流运输:在物流运输中,路径优化算法可以帮助物流企业规划最佳的运输路线,提高运输效率,降低成本,还可以根据货物的性质、数量等因素进行调度优化,提高物流系统的整体性能。
3、交通管理:路径优化算法可以用于交通管理中,帮助交通管理部门规划城市交通网络,优化交通信号灯控制,提高城市交通的通行效率。
4、通信网络:在通信网络中,路径优化算法可以用于路由选择,帮助数据包选择最优的路径进行传输,提高通信网络的性能和稳定性。
最新进展与趋势
近年来,路径优化算法的研究取得了许多重要进展,传统的路径优化算法得到了不断的改进和优化,提高了求解效率和精度,随着人工智能和机器学习技术的发展,一些新的路径优化算法被提出并应用于实际场景中,以下是当前路径优化算法的最新进展与趋势:
1、启发式算法:启发式算法是一种基于经验和直觉的搜索策略,能够在求解复杂问题时提供较好的解决方案,近年来,一些启发式算法如蚁群算法、遗传算法等被广泛应用于路径优化问题中,取得了良好的效果。
2、机器学习技术:机器学习技术可以帮助路径优化算法学习历史数据和模式,提高算法的预测和决策能力,利用神经网络和深度学习技术预测交通拥堵情况,从而优化导航路线。
3、大数据与云计算技术:随着大数据和云计算技术的发展,路径优化算法可以处理更加复杂的数据和场景,通过云计算平台,可以处理海量数据,提高算法的求解效率和精度,大数据技术还可以帮助分析用户的出行习惯和偏好,为个性化服务提供支持。
4、多目标优化:多目标优化是当前的热点研究方向之一,在路径优化问题中,不仅要考虑距离、时间等单一目标,还需要考虑多个目标之间的权衡和折衷,在物流运输中同时考虑运输成本、运输时间和货物质量等多个目标,多目标优化算法可以帮助企业在多个目标之间找到最优的均衡解。
路径优化算法是计算机科学领域中的重要算法之一,具有广泛的应用场景,本文介绍了路径优化算法的基本概念、分类、应用场景以及最新进展与趋势,随着人工智能、机器学习等技术的发展,路径优化算法将在更多领域得到应用和发展,我们需要进一步研究和探索新的路径优化算法和技术,以满足不断增长的需求和提高求解效率和精度。





